This guide is primarily intended for individuals who are considering or have started a new AI safety university group.
Before you get started, double-check whether there is already a group in your university or city, and try to find out if there are other people interested in starting a group - maybe you can work together. If there are existing AI safety groups in nearby cities or universities, it might be helpful to get involved in them before you embark on your own.

This guide contains a compilation of ideas from different sources and different experiences. Every organizer and group is different, and ideas that work well for one group may need to be adapted to work for another. So, use this guide as a starting point rather than a prescription, and seek advice from others.
